There are many ways to help out at SMA. Some opportunities continue throughout the school year, such as counting Campbell's Soup labels or being a cafeteria helper; some are sporadic, such as the beautification committee, which plants flowers and rakes leaves; and some are one-time events, such as the uniform swap or the spaghetti supper. Can't come to school during the day? No problem -- package up Box Tops or provide baked goods for an event, or choose many other ways to help from home. For further information on ways to volunteer, contact the coordinator listed. Everyone is welcome to help -- moms,dads, grandparents, aunts, uncles -- and it's a great way to meet other SMA families. Curriculum Volunteer
Contact: Mrs. Wood, cwood@stmaryacademy.org
Volunteer Opportunities: Help SMA teachers with projects, at the discretion of the individual teacher. The teacher will show the volunteer exactly what she needs done, as well as arrange times for the volunteer to be present in the classroom. Special requirements: Volunteer must have attended "Protecting God's Children" Volunteer may not be a math helper for any grade attended by one of his or her own children. Time: Ongoing throughout the school year; approximately 2 hours per week, but this is arranged on an individual basis between the teacher and the volunteer according to the teacher's needs and the volunteer's availability. Uniform Swap
Contact: Corinna Dugmore, dugmore5@comcast.net
Date: TBD for 2012
Set up uniforms that have been dropped off by families to sell. The money collected is then returned to the families or donated to the school - depending on the family's request. At the end of the evening sort the uniforms & monies for families to collect on the same evening.
Volunteer Opportunities:
* Set up tables and uniforms (1.5-2 hours) * Sell uniforms and sort money (3 hours) * Clean up (.5-1 hour)
